On 1/13/2023 2:23 PM, Paul M Stillwell Jr wrote:
> Users want the ability to debug FW issues by retrieving the
> FW logs from the E8xx devices. Enable devlink to query the driver
> to see if the NVM image allows FW logging and to see if FW
> logging is currently running. The set command is not supported
> at this time.
> 
> This is the beginning of the v2 for FW logging.

This also includes a bunch of boilerplate code needed by FW logging v2,
and that's not clearly mentioned in the commit message. That is probably
clear to most revewiers though.

In theory you could split that stuff out to a separate patch and only
include the bare minimum necessary to check of NVM supports fw logging
in this patch. I wouldnt' change this unless you have a reason to make
another v7 though.

> diff --git a/drivers/net/ethernet/intel/ice/ice_fwlog.c b/drivers/net/ethernet/intel/ice/ice_fwlog.c
> new file mode 100644
> index 000000000000..fac970f03dd0
> --- /dev/null
> +++ b/drivers/net/ethernet/intel/ice/ice_fwlog.c
> @@ -0,0 +1,117 @@
> +// SPDX-License-Identifier: GPL-2.0
> +/* Copyright (c) 2022, Intel Corporation. */
> +
> +#include "ice_common.h"
> +#include "ice_fwlog.h"
> +
> +/**
> + * ice_fwlog_supported - Cached for whether FW supports FW logging or not
> + * @hw: pointer to the HW structure
> + *
> + * This will always return false if called before ice_init_hw(), so it must be
> + * called after ice_init_hw().
> + */
> +bool ice_fwlog_supported(struct ice_hw *hw)
> +{
> +	return hw->fwlog_supported;
> +}
> +
> +/**
> + * ice_aq_fwlog_get - Get the current firmware logging configuration (0xFF32)
> + * @hw: pointer to the HW structure
> + * @cfg: firmware logging configuration to populate
> + */
> +static int
> +ice_aq_fwlog_get(struct ice_hw *hw, struct ice_fwlog_cfg *cfg)
> +{
> +	struct ice_aqc_fw_log_cfg_resp *fw_modules;
> +	struct ice_aqc_fw_log *cmd;
> +	struct ice_aq_desc desc;
> +	u16 module_id_cnt;
> +	int status;
> +	void *buf;
> +	int i;
> +
> +	memset(cfg, 0, sizeof(*cfg));
> +
> +	buf = kzalloc(ICE_AQ_MAX_BUF_LEN, GFP_KERNEL);
> +	if (!buf)
> +		return -ENOMEM;
> +
> +	ice_fill_dflt_direct_cmd_desc(&desc, ice_aqc_opc_fw_logs_query);
> +	cmd = &desc.params.fw_log;
> +
> +	cmd->cmd_flags = ICE_AQC_FW_LOG_AQ_QUERY;
> +
> +	status = ice_aq_send_cmd(hw, &desc, buf, ICE_AQ_MAX_BUF_LEN, NULL);
> +	if (status) {
> +		ice_debug(hw, ICE_DBG_FW_LOG, "Failed to get FW log configuration\n");
> +		goto status_out;
> +	}
> +
> +	module_id_cnt = le16_to_cpu(cmd->ops.cfg.mdl_cnt);
> +	if (module_id_cnt < ICE_AQC_FW_LOG_ID_MAX) {
> +		ice_debug(hw, ICE_DBG_FW_LOG, "FW returned less than the expected number of FW log module IDs\n");
> +	} else if (module_id_cnt > ICE_AQC_FW_LOG_ID_MAX) {
> +		ice_debug(hw, ICE_DBG_FW_LOG, "FW returned more than expected number of FW log module IDs, setting module_id_cnt to software expected max %u\n",
> +			  ICE_AQC_FW_LOG_ID_MAX);
> +		module_id_cnt = ICE_AQC_FW_LOG_ID_MAX;
> +	}
> +
> +	cfg->log_resolution = le16_to_cpu(cmd->ops.cfg.log_resolution);
> +	if (cmd->cmd_flags & ICE_AQC_FW_LOG_CONF_AQ_EN)
> +		cfg->options |= ICE_FWLOG_OPTION_ARQ_ENA;
> +	if (cmd->cmd_flags & ICE_AQC_FW_LOG_CONF_UART_EN)
> +		cfg->options |= ICE_FWLOG_OPTION_UART_ENA;
> +	if (cmd->cmd_flags & ICE_AQC_FW_LOG_QUERY_REGISTERED)
> +		cfg->options |= ICE_FWLOG_OPTION_IS_REGISTERED;
> +
> +	fw_modules = (struct ice_aqc_fw_log_cfg_resp *)buf;
> +
> +	for (i = 0; i < module_id_cnt; i++) {
> +		struct ice_aqc_fw_log_cfg_resp *fw_module = &fw_modules[i];
> +
> +		cfg->module_entries[i].module_id =
> +			le16_to_cpu(fw_module->module_identifier);
> +		cfg->module_entries[i].log_level = fw_module->log_level;
> +	}
> +
> +status_out:
> +	kfree(buf);
> +	return status;
> +}
> +
> +/**
> + * ice_fwlog_set_supported - Set if FW logging is supported by FW
> + * @hw: pointer to the HW struct
> + *
> + * If FW returns success to the ice_aq_fwlog_get call then it supports FW
> + * logging, else it doesn't. Set the fwlog_supported flag accordingly.
> + *
> + * This function is only meant to be called during driver init to determine if
> + * the FW support FW logging.
> + */
> +void ice_fwlog_set_supported(struct ice_hw *hw)
> +{
> +	struct ice_fwlog_cfg *cfg;
> +	int status;
> +
> +	hw->fwlog_supported = false;
> +
> +	cfg = kzalloc(sizeof(*cfg), GFP_KERNEL);
> +	if (!cfg)
> +		return;
> +
> +	/* don't call ice_fwlog_get() because that would overwrite the cached
> +	 * configuration from the call to ice_fwlog_init(), which is expected to
> +	 * be called prior to this function
> +	 */
> +	status = ice_aq_fwlog_get(hw, cfg);
> +	if (status)
> +		ice_debug(hw, ICE_DBG_FW_LOG, "ice_aq_fwlog_get failed, FW logging is not supported on this version of FW, status %d\n",
> +			  status);
> +	else
> +		hw->fwlog_supported = true;
> +
> +	kfree(cfg);
> +}
> diff --git a/drivers/net/ethernet/intel/ice/ice_fwlog.h b/drivers/net/ethernet/intel/ice/ice_fwlog.h
> new file mode 100644
> index 000000000000..3a2c83502763
> --- /dev/null
> +++ b/drivers/net/ethernet/intel/ice/ice_fwlog.h
> @@ -0,0 +1,52 @@
> +/* SPDX-License-Identifier: GPL-2.0 */
> +/* Copyright (C) 2022, Intel Corporation. */
> +
> +#ifndef _ICE_FWLOG_H_
> +#define _ICE_FWLOG_H_
> +#include "ice_adminq_cmd.h"
> +
> +struct ice_hw;
> +
> +/* Only a single log level should be set and all log levels under the set value
> + * are enabled, e.g. if log level is set to ICE_FW_LOG_LEVEL_VERBOSE, then all
> + * other log levels are included (except ICE_FW_LOG_LEVEL_NONE)
> + */
> +enum ice_fwlog_level {
> +	ICE_FWLOG_LEVEL_NONE = 0,
> +	ICE_FWLOG_LEVEL_ERROR = 1,
> +	ICE_FWLOG_LEVEL_WARNING = 2,
> +	ICE_FWLOG_LEVEL_NORMAL = 3,
> +	ICE_FWLOG_LEVEL_VERBOSE = 4,
> +	ICE_FWLOG_LEVEL_INVALID, /* all values >= this entry are invalid */
> +};
> +
> +struct ice_fwlog_module_entry {
> +	/* module ID for the corresponding firmware logging event */
> +	u16 module_id;
> +	/* verbosity level for the module_id */
> +	u8 log_level;
> +};
> +
> +struct ice_fwlog_cfg {
> +	/* list of modules for configuring log level */
> +	struct ice_fwlog_module_entry module_entries[ICE_AQC_FW_LOG_ID_MAX];
> +	/* options used to configure firmware logging */
> +	u16 options;
> +#define ICE_FWLOG_OPTION_ARQ_ENA		BIT(0)
> +#define ICE_FWLOG_OPTION_UART_ENA		BIT(1)
> +	/* set before calling ice_fwlog_init() so the PF registers for firmware
> +	 * logging on initialization
> +	 */
> +#define ICE_FWLOG_OPTION_REGISTER_ON_INIT	BIT(2)
> +	/* set in the ice_fwlog_get() response if the PF is registered for FW
> +	 * logging events over ARQ
> +	 */
> +#define ICE_FWLOG_OPTION_IS_REGISTERED		BIT(3)
> +
> +	/* minimum number of log events sent per Admin Receive Queue event */
> +	u16 log_resolution;
> +};
> +
> +void ice_fwlog_set_supported(struct ice_hw *hw);
> +bool ice_fwlog_supported(struct ice_hw *hw);
> +#endif /* _ICE_FWLOG_H_ */
